If you're looking for something new to watch but not sure what's worth your time, don't worry. We got you! This week the team dives in to (spoiler-FREE) reviews of some films that came out in August. 

Shantae reviews Reminiscence starring Hugh Jackman and Rebecca Ferguson: a new sci-fi thriller written and directed by Lisa Joy and available on HBOMax. 

Alex jumps into the Marvel Cinematic Universe with Black Widow. The new action-packed adventure stars Scarlett Johansson and Florence Pugh and is directed by Cate Shortland. 

Dave reviews The Night House, which is a new, nail-bitting horror available in theaters directed by David Bruckner and starring Rebecca Hall. 

Finally, Anselm finishes up with Leos Carax's Annette starring Adam Driver and Marion Cotillard in a strange rock opera musical available on Prime Video that will leave you scratching your heads.
